| +namespace policy { |
| + |
| +// Scheduler for driving repeated asynchronous tasks such as e.g. policy |
| +// fetches. Subsequent tasks are guaranteed not to overlap. Tasks are posted to |
| +// the current thread and therefore must not block (suitable e.g. for |
| +// asynchronous D-Bus calls). |
| +// Tasks scheduling begins immediately after instantiation of the class. Upon |
| +// destruction, scheduled but not yet started tasks are cancelled. The result of |
| +// started but not finished tasks is NOT reported. |
| +class POLICY_EXPORT PolicyScheduler { |
| + public: |
| + // Callback for the task to report success or failure. |
| + using TaskCallback = base::OnceCallback<void(bool success)>; |
| + |
| + // Task to be performed at regular intervals. The task takes a |callback| to |
| + // return success or failure. |
| + using Task = base::RepeatingCallback<void(TaskCallback callback)>; |
| + |
| + // Callback for PolicyScheduler to report success or failure of the tasks. |
| + using SchedulerCallback = base::RepeatingCallback<void(bool success)>; |
| + |
| + // Defines the |task| to be run every |interval| and the |callback| for the |
| + // scheduler to report the result. In case a task runs longer than the |
| + // |interval| the next task is backed off the completion time of the previous |
| + // task by |backoff_interval|. (Intervals are computed as the time difference |
| + // between the end of the previous and the start of the subsequent task.) |
